Profiles in Dual Language Education in the 21st Century

Published Year
2019
Resource Type
Book
This book is devoted to dual language education (DLE). The authors of the eight chapters cover topics such as the attributes of a successful DLE model, policies needed, teacher preparation, and the challenges and opportunities of extending a DLE model to preschool and secondary settings.

Engaging Research: Transforming Practices for the Middle School Classroom

Published Year
2018
Resource Type
Book
This book, published by TESOL Press, is part of a series devoted to translating conceptual and empirical research into practices. This book focuses on the middle school grades. It is divided into four sections: language arts, social studies, science, and mathematics.
